I would suggest a few things: 1. don't make repetitive log entries every day " managed rental, did calls" copied and pasted 50 times likely would be thrown out in an audit for example. 2. make sure you are materially participating in your rental activities. 750 hours is not enough, you need to pass the second test of material participation in the rental activities to turn that activity from passive to active and claim the deductions on your active income.
